> I'm not talking about the disklabel here.  geom_vinum takes up the first
> 265 sectors (512 bytes each) to store its configuration.  These are
> straight-up disks that aren't needed in Windoze or other OS-- just plain
> FreeBSD, so we use the full disks without labels or MBR partitions.

> > Aren't you going to run into issues with your filesystems when moving 
> > from one architecture to another that uses a different bus width?
> 
> How so?  Are you saying there are bugs in UFS which will prevent this from
> working?  If so, this is a much bigger problem than I anticipated.  Looking
> at sys/ufs/ffs/fs.h, I do see a bunch of pointers in the superblock
> structure ("struct fs"), but all other superblock fields and other on-disk
> structures have fixed size values.  Also there's a sanity test on the size
> of the "struct fs".  Someone clearly has thought of this problem
> (McKusick ?).  After some minimal testing of mounting i386-created UFS2
> volumes on amd64, everything seems to work just fine.
> 
> I've also investigated geom_mirror, and the on-disk structure seems clean.
> There may be others that are broken, but geom_vinum is what I've noticed
> and that is what I intend to fix.  If UFS *is* broken, it should be fixed
> also.
